I've been reading these boards for about 6 years but rarely ever post. I just have a question now that i got a tattoo on my inner bicep. Does anyone know if its ok to lift while its still healing? Thanks for any help.

But you are meant to let the tattoo heal and scab over a bit. Training could rub and irritate the tattoo and would be the same as picking at the scab which can affect how it will look. Also training will make you sweat, which isn't good when the tattoo is new.

Don't train, it will stretch the tattoo while it heals and could actually create scar tissue that looks like stretch marks in your tat. Just wait until it's healed completely, 7-10 days.
